CA Mobile Authenticator SDK Compatibility with Android API Target Level 36
search cancel

CA Mobile Authenticator SDK Compatibility with Android API Target Level 36

book

Article ID: 440044

calendar_today

Updated On:

Products

CA Strong Authentication

Issue/Introduction

Customers integrating the CA Mobile Authenticator SDK into Android applications may need to comply with new Google Play Store requirements mandating the use of Android API Target Level 36.

Whether CA Mobile Authenticator SDK version 2.2.3 is fully compatible with compileSdkVersion 36 and targetSdkVersion 36 and whether any known limitations or required SDK changes exist for this migration?

Environment

 

CA Mobile Authenticator SDK (CA Advanced Authentication):

  • Android Authenticator SDK
  • Android AuthID SDK
  • Android DDNA SDK

 

Resolution

The current CA Mobile Authenticator SDK was originally built using:

  • compileSdkVersion 34
  • targetSdkVersion 35

However, customers can independently update their Android application configuration to:

  • compileSdkVersion 36
  • targetSdkVersion 36

without requiring modifications to the existing SDK integration.

Our engineering team has confirmed that the SDK functions correctly when the host application targets Android API Level 36.

As part of an internal validation initiative for Android API Target Level 36 compliance:

  • The CA Mobile Authenticator SDK target SDK has been updated to version 36
  • The SDK has been rebuilt successfully
  • Validation testing completed successfully within Broadcom internal application environments

Although Google Play Store enforcement for previously published applications targeting lower SDK versions has not yet fully restricted updates or publishing, Broadcom recommends adopting the newly validated SDK versions as a preventive and safeguard measure moving forward.

Broadcom recommends using the newly validated Android SDK components for all future mobile authenticator integrations targeting API Level 36.